Episode 53: The Haunted Lemp Mansion (St. Louis, Missouri) 25.05.2021

The Lemp Mansion in St. Louis, Missouri, is said to be one of the ten most haunted places in America. The mansion continues to play host to the tragic Lemp family after death. The once stately home to millionaires became office space, then decayed into a run-down boarding house. Finally restored, the Lemp Mansion is now a dinner theatre, restaurant, and bed & breakfast.

Episode 37: Freetown-Fall River State Forest and The Vile Vortices 08.12.2020

A forest stroll is usually a peaceful activity – unless you’re in Freetown-Fall River State Forest. The majority of these woods, usually referred to as Freetown State Forest, pass through Freetown's center itself.  If you dare, you can meander the 50 miles of unpaved roads and trails, which cut through its 5,441-acres.
